Does Ryzen 5 7600X Bottleneck RX 7900 GRE?

0 viewsUpdated 22 Apr 2026

Quick Answer

No, the Ryzen 5 7600X does not bottleneck the RX 7900 GRE. This Zen 4 CPU has excellent single-thread performance that keeps the 7900 GRE running at full speed. At 1440p, you will see less than 3% performance difference versus a Ryzen 7 7700X.

Ryzen 5 7600X + RX 7900 GRE: Perfect Mid-Range Match

The RX 7900 GRE is AMD's excellent mid-range GPU sitting between the RX 7800 XT and RX 7900 XT. The Ryzen 5 7600X is a natural pairing on the AM5 platform.

1440p Gaming Results

  • Cyberpunk 2077 (1440p Ultra): 78 fps
  • Baldur's Gate 3 (1440p Ultra): 85 fps
  • Alan Wake 2 (1440p Medium): 72 fps
  • Fortnite (1440p High): 144+ fps
  • Helldivers 2 (1440p High): 90 fps

Why This Pairing Works

The Ryzen 5 7600X boosts to 5.3 GHz and has the same Zen 4 IPC as more expensive AMD chips. For gaming, clock speed and IPC matter more than core count, and the 7600X delivers both. The RX 7900 GRE is powerful but not so powerful that it outpaces a 6-core Zen 4 chip.

All-AMD Platform Benefits

Running both AMD CPU and GPU enables Smart Access Memory (SAM), which can provide a 2-5% performance uplift in supported titles. This is a free performance boost just for staying on the AMD ecosystem.
